V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  miniliuke  ›  全部回复第 30 页 / 共 34 页
回复总数  670
1 ... 22  23  24  25  26  27  28  29  30  31 ... 34  
2018-08-31 10:13:08 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
使用 tcpdump -n -i veth1,tcpdump -n -i bridge
172.8.0.6 发现 ping 172.8.0.6 没有包,同时 bridge 也监控着发现也没有包......
2018-08-30 08:32:41 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
@shelterz centos......应该关了虚拟机上不了外网,但互相能 ping 通了
2018-08-30 07:52:18 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
@zrp1994 又建了一台,重点是 ping 不通自己啊
2018-08-29 17:34:35 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
ping 自己 ping 不通也太骚气了
2018-08-29 11:20:21 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
@zrp1994 图不太好发

这是虚拟机 172.8.0.6 的:
broadcast 172.8.0.0 dev veth1 proto kernel scope link src 172.8.0.6
local 172.8.0.6 dev veth1 proto kernel scope host src 172.8.0.6
broadcast 172.8.255.255 dev veth1 proto kernel scope link src 172.8.0.6

这是主机的:

broadcast 127.0.0.0 dev lo proto kernel scope link src 127.0.0.1
local 127.0.0.0/8 dev lo proto kernel scope host src 127.0.0.1
local 127.0.0.1 dev lo proto kernel scope host src 127.0.0.1
broadcast 127.255.255.255 dev lo proto kernel scope link src 127.0.0.1
broadcast 172.8.0.0 dev sgdocker0 proto kernel scope link src 172.8.0.1
local 172.8.0.1 dev sgdocker0 proto kernel scope host src 172.8.0.1
broadcast 172.8.255.255 dev sgdocker0 proto kernel scope link src 172.8.0.1
broadcast 172.17.0.0 dev docker0 proto kernel scope link src 172.17.0.1
local 172.17.0.1 dev docker0 proto kernel scope host src 172.17.0.1
broadcast 172.17.255.255 dev docker0 proto kernel scope link src 172.17.0.1
broadcast 172.21.0.0 dev eth0 proto kernel scope link src 172.21.0.16
local 172.21.0.16 dev eth0 proto kernel scope host src 172.21.0.16
broadcast 172.21.15.255 dev eth0 proto kernel scope link src 172.21.0.16

其中 172.17 的是 docker 相关的,172.21 是这台主机在的网络
2018-08-29 09:33:52 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
我把 iptables 关了,外网上不了了,能 ping 其他虚拟机,但 ping 不通自己 ip
2018-08-29 09:22:52 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
@e1eph4nt 的确有,没有写上去
2018-08-29 09:10:33 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
还有,为什么我没有开 iptables,它也能起作用......
2018-08-29 09:06:40 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
@e1eph4nt 我虚拟机 route 只有一条规则,默认路由为 172.8.0.1
2018-08-29 08:59:21 +08:00
回复了 miniliuke 创建的主题 问与答 Linux bridge 网络问题
没有人配置过吗?
2018-08-28 20:26:26 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 的确是这个问题
2018-08-28 16:54:59 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@henglinli 发现全是 Golang 的锅,现在只有一个问题了,为什么 mount --bind /proc/22752/ns/mnt namespace/test/mnt 会报错.......报错:mount: wrong fs type, bad option, bad superblock on /proc/22752/ns/mnt,missing codepage or helper program, or other error
2018-08-28 16:52:13 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x
@zealot0630 看了 docker 的实现,终于知道为什么加载不了 mnt ns 了,是 golang 的锅......但是 mount --bind /proc/22752/ns/mnt namespace/test/mnt 还是会报错,不知道为什么 mnt 不能被 mount,其他都可以,可能有什么奇奇怪怪的机制吧
2018-08-28 14:00:33 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@zealot0630 那为什么 setns 无法设置 mnt namespace,这又是为什么......
2018-08-28 13:43:40 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@miniliuke 报错 mount: wrong fs type, bad option, bad superblock on /proc/14422/ns/mnt,
missing codepage or helper program, or other error

In some cases useful info is found in syslog - try
dmesg | tail or so.
2018-08-28 13:38:23 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 就是为将 /proc/进程号 /ns 里面的文件不在进程结束时被销毁,使用 mount 命令挂载到其他文件上,但是只有 mnt 文件没有被挂载上,也不能 setns......
2018-08-28 12:14:55 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 对了,大佬还有我去 mount 命名空间只有 mnt ns 没有 mount 上且没有报错,为什么啊? pid 的问题我能理解但解决不了,mnt 的问题我都不知道为什么......
2018-08-28 12:10:13 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 但是 pid namespace 是一样的啊,就是 ls -l /proc/1/ns,发现还是同一个 pid ns
2018-08-28 12:08:52 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 但我自己实现时关闭 pid1 后 pid ns 就不能新建进程但是能 setns,
2018-08-28 12:05:04 +08:00
回复了 miniliuke 创建的主题 Linux Linux 中 Pid 和 Mnt 命名空间重用的问题
@raysonx 甚至于我关闭 docker 以后重启还是同一个 pid ns,除非我关机
1 ... 22  23  24  25  26  27  28  29  30  31 ... 34  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1249 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 16ms · UTC 23:46 · PVG 07:46 · LAX 15:46 · JFK 18:46
Developed with CodeLauncher
♥ Do have faith in what you're doing.